概括
本研究介绍了用于结构工程的量子计算 (QC) 的元启发学,将基于量子的和搜索 (QbHS) 应用到托管拓优化 (TTO). 新的方法改善了对传统算法的融合,推进了架构和计算机信息系统.

背景情况:
- 量子计算 (QC) 是第四次工业革命的一个关键技术.
- 使用QC的元启发算法主要是在计算机工程中开发的.
- 质量控制在建筑最佳设计中的应用有限.
研究的目的:
- 提出和评估将量子位集成到基于量子的和搜索 (QbHS) 算法中的新方法.
- 将这些方法应用于结构工程中的结构拓优化 (TTO).
- 为了比较不同量子比特采用策略的性能.
主要方法:
- 开发了四种不同的方法来采用量子比特在QbHS算法的调节.
- 应用了修改后的QbHS算法来解决拓优化 (TTO) 问题.
- 分析了基于量子比特采用和代数的融合性能.
主要成果:
- 与传统的和搜索 (HS) 算法相比,所有四种提出的方法都表现出优越的融合性能.
- 在四种量子比特采用方法中,融合性能各不相同.
- 采用的量子比特数量通常保持稳定或随着代的变化而减少.
结论:
- 整合QC元启发学,特别是QbHS与量子比特采用,显示了结构工程最佳设计的希望.
- 这些进步预计将有利于建筑设计和计算机信息系统.
- 进一步的研究可以探索QC在工程优化中的各种应用.

The method of joints is a commonly used technique to analyze the forces in structural trusses. The method is based on the principle of equilibrium, which assumes that the truss members are connected by frictionless pins. The forces at each joint can be determined by considering the equilibrium of the forces acting on that joint.
